Remembering Christ’s Sacrifice Rightly
In Part 16 of Healthy Living in a Sick World, Dr. Michael Youssef issues a sobering warning from 1 Corinthians 11: do not approach the Lord’s Table in an unworthy manner. The Communion table is not a religious ritual—it is a holy remembrance of Christ’s sacrifice, a call to self-examination, and a proclamation of the Gospel until He returns. Dr. Youssef exposes how careless, carnal attitudes among believers dishonor Christ, grieve the Holy Spirit, and bring judgment upon the Church. This episode calls all believers to repent of sin, forgive others, and revere the cross with pure hearts. God is not looking for ceremony—He is calling His people to brokenness, gratitude, and obedience. Remember rightly—or risk forgetting eternally.
